We've chosen our top five new looks from the 2015 Fashion Shows to help you select your new wardrobe for autumn. A mix of new looks and twists on old favourites
Picture
1.Stripes
Horizontal, vertical or diagonal, stripes are everywhere this season! Designers used stripes in a rainbow of colours, but black and white was especially popular.
 
2.Monochrome Checks
In all sizes of check and all types, from dogs tooth and gingham to large windowpane check. Black and white are the smartest, especially when teamed with coloured accessories. One checked item is enough at a time, picking out one colour for accessories. A checked coat or tailored jacket looks great with a simple dress in a plain colour.
 
3.Maroon
This is the key colour this season, and it goes so well with other warm autumn shades such as black and chocolate brown. Whether for smart workwear or cosy leisurewear it has a warmth and depth that suits most complexions. For evening wear choose silver shoes and jewellery. Soft fabrics like velvet are great in these warm shades.  Other key colours to look for this season are petrol blue, teal and khaki.
 
4.Duster Coats and Jackets
A duster coat is full or calf length, and oversized in a lightweight fabric.  Long jackets and waistcoats in semi sheer floaty fabric are everywhere this season. Pair them with a fitted dress or top and skinny jeans underneath. It’s a great way of showing off your curves in a fitted outfit, without feeling to exposed. This look is really popular with celebrities like Kim Kardashian.

5.Bold Print Leggings
A welcome return this summer and even more popular this autumn but with a twist! Vivid colours and bold patterns give a new twist to an old favourite. Try stripes or checks too. 

These looks are all really wearable, and will see you through autumn and into winter.
